As a Bank Residential Senior Carer at a Barchester care home, you'll look after the different needs of our residents to enable us to deliver quality, person-centred care and support. You will be responsible for leading a team of care staff, which will include training, supervisions and delegating duties on shift. You will also support with the administering and ordering of medication, reviewing and updating resident care plans and risk assessment, and liaising with GP's, district nursing teams and resident family members.

Like everyone here, as a Residential Senior Care Assistant, you'll always respect the dignity and preferences of our residents as well playing your own part in creating an environment that's warm, welcoming and vibrant. The successful candidate will have NVQ Level 3 or Advanced Diploma in Health & Social Care to join us as a Residential Senior Care Assistant. You will have previous experience in a residential care setting along with proven team leadership skills and the ability to make appropriate decisions to support the needs and wellbeing of our Residents.

We're looking for people who are warm-hearted, compassionate and committed to giving each resident individualised care and support. You'll have the opportunity to develop your career through ongoing training opportunities, so there's no limit to how far you can go with us. Many of our Senior Carer Assistants progress into Care Practitioners, Care Community Leads or on to nursing pathways.

As this is a Bank position to provide cover as and when we need it, such as for annual leave or sick leave, the hours and days you work will vary.

How to prepare for a job interview at Barchester Healthcare

Know Your Care Principles

Make sure you brush up on the key principles of person-centred care. Be ready to discuss how you’ve applied these in your previous roles, especially in leading a team and supporting residents' individual needs.

Showcase Your Leadership Skills

Prepare examples that highlight your experience in training and supervising staff. Think about specific situations where you successfully delegated tasks or resolved conflicts within your team.

Familiarise Yourself with Medication Protocols

Since you'll be involved in administering and ordering medication, it’s crucial to understand the relevant protocols. Be prepared to discuss your experience with medication management and how you ensure compliance with safety standards.

Emphasise Your Compassionate Approach

During the interview, convey your warm-hearted nature and commitment to resident care. Share stories that illustrate your compassion and how you respect the dignity and preferences of those you care for.
